Output dd89939e2b38d2bd2b6a02a9f870f43be64f50bcf89b677eda92fa26f6ecdb1a:39

value
4440551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89775815c101ebc2a0dff3c5d66a41bbd61d0b4b OP_EQUAL
address
3EDsTzmAww35pkUVcThusvk2cJedaEV8Qq
transaction
dd89939e2b38d2bd2b6a02a9f870f43be64f50bcf89b677eda92fa26f6ecdb1a
confirmations
488479
spent
true